The general goal will be the comparison of different bioreactors for liquid culture in TIS (Plantform, SETIS, ElecTIS) compared to the conventional methods of in vitro propagation in gelled (semi-solid) medium, working with fruit-trees species of high economic importance in the nursery activity of Albania and Italy (native and wild cultivars of cherry and almond, peach rootstocks, myrtle and pomegranate).
The objectives are the following:
1. stabilization of effective in vitro culture protocols by conventional techniques of solidified and “double phase” media;
2. knowledge, application and comparison of innovative bioreactors for liquid culture in TIS (Plantform, SETIS, ElecTIS);
3. selection of the best bioreactor for TIS and comparison with conventional in vitro propagation methods based on the use of semi-solid medium as for: quality of the material, costs of production, implementation in commercial micropropagation laboratory;
4. awareness of specialists, young researchers, farmers and fruit-tree nurseries for the advantages and benefits of liquid culture by TIS by the organization of specific conferences/workshops, and the publication of scientific and technical notes;
5. enrichment of in vitro culture laboratories in Albania (laboratories in FNS, Tirana, and of CATT, Vlora) with the innovative technology for Albania;
6. widening knowledge in the potentiality of liquid culture in TIS by its application to Albanian and Italian valuable fruit germplasm.
